Storage of Customer Equipment. Xxxxx 0 may, at its option, agree to store equipment that Customer intends to colocate in Customer's Colocation Space for not more than forty five (45) days prior to the applicable Customer Commit Date. Storage of such equipment is purely incidental to the Service ordered by Customer and Level 3 will not charge Customer a fee for such storage. No document delivered as part of such storage shall be deemed a warehouse receipt. Absent Level 3's gross negligence or intentional misconduct, Level 3 shall have no liability to Customer or any third party arising from such storage. In the event Customer stores equipment for longer than forty five (45) days, Xxxxx 0 may, but shall not be obligated to, return Customer's equipment to Customer without liability, at Customer's sole cost and expense.
